Families who have been resettled in the county spoke to officers
Refugees from Afghanistan say they were victims of hate crime after moving to Northamptonshire, according to police. this week of the abuse they had faced at the hands of some people in the county.
Positive action support officer Neil Goosey provided information about the employment opportunities available within Northamptonshire Police as part of the Force’s recruitment campaign.Speaking after their visit on Monday , Nick Stephens said: “We work very closely with our local authority colleagues to provide support to everyone who has resettled in the county.
